New York – Paris Flight Diverts to Ireland So Passengers Can Use the Bathroom
The Christmas Day departure of British Airways subsidiary OpenSkies flight BA8004 from Newark to Paris diverted to Shannon, Ireland for a bathroom break.

Starwood Partnership With Virgin America Ending January 6, Transfer Points Now
When transfers from Starwood to Virgin America briefly disappeared from the Starwood website a week ago it looked like a change without notice, the elimination of a partnership driven by Alaska’s acquisition of Virgin America. After all, it was separately announced that Citibank would lose the ability to transfer points to Virgin America as well.
Fortunately the ability to transfer points to Virgin America return to SPG.com and always remained available by phone. It shouldn’t surprise anyone, of course, that Starwood’s partnership with Virgin America is ending however.
Over 650 IHG Hotels Will Change Points Prices January 15. And Two-Thirds Get More Expensive (Mostly in the U.S.)
IHG Rewards Club has posted a .pdf of hotels that will be changing rewards redemption category on January 15.
About 650 hotels are changing category. Of those, about 75% are going to cost more points to redeem starting January 15th. Two-thirds of the hotels that are changing category are in the U.S. Over 90% of those are going up in category and price.
American Flight Runs Out of Airsickness Bags, Diverts to Uruguay on Christmas
On Christmas Eve, American’s flight from Dallas to Buenos Aires ran into trouble on final approach. As it prepared to land in Buenos Aires, weather forced it to divert to Montevideo.
Turbulence was so bad as the plane tried to land in Buenos Aires initially that perhaps half the passengers on the plane threw up and the aircraft ran out of airsickness bags. And there was reporedly a lightning strike as well.
